Setting Realistic Fitness Goals

Setting fitness goals is an incredible way to embark on a transformative journey, but finding the right balance between ambition and achievability is key! Here's a guide on setting realistic and achievable fitness goals:

  • Start with Clarity: Define what you want to achieve. Is it weight loss, strength gain, improved endurance, or overall wellbeing? Specificity is crucial!

  • Be SMART: Make your goals SMART -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ound. This framework helps ensure your goals are clear and attainable.

  • Break It Down: Chunk your larger goal into smaller, manageable milestones. This step-by-step approach allows for consistent progress and prevents overwhelm.

  • Embrace Realistic Expectations: Acknowledge where you are in your fitness journey. Progress takes time, so set goals that challenge you without being unattainable.

  • Put It in Writing: Document your goals! Whether it's in a journal or on your phone, having them written down keeps you accountable and serves as a reminder of your focus.

  • Seek Support: Don't go it alone! Engage with our expert trainers or other members. Support and guidance make your goals more achievable.

  • Stay Flexible: Be adaptable! Life can throw curveballs. Adjust your goals when necessary, but keep the end vision in mind.

  • Celebrate Every Milestone: Acknowledge and celebrate your achievements along the way. Small victories contribute to the bigger picture.
